About Kotla
Kotla is a small hill town situated on the Pathankot–Dharamshala road, in Himachal Pradesh, India. It is located in the Kangra district. The town is about 45 kilometres (28 mi) from Pathankot and the same distance from Dharamshala. Its geographical coordinates are 32° 15' 0" North, 76° 2' 0" East.

Monthly Weather
| Month | Avg Temperature | Precipitation | Summary |
|---|---|---|---|
| January | 52°F (11°C) | 4.3 in | Coldest |
| February | 57°F (14°C) | 3.1 in | |
| March | 65°F (18°C) | 3.6 in | |
| April | 74°F (23°C) | 1.6 in | |
| May | 83°F (28°C) | 1.6 in | |
| June | 86°F (30°C) | 4.5 in | Warmest |
| July | 80°F (27°C) | 23.3 in | |
| August | 78°F (26°C) | 23.4 in | Wettest |
| September | 77°F (25°C) | 10.6 in | |
| October | 71°F (22°C) | 1.9 in | |
| November | 62°F (17°C) | 0.7 in | Driest |
| December | 56°F (13°C) | 2.1 in |
Kotla has a seasonal temperature swing of 34°F / from 52°F in January to 86°F in June. Total annual precipitation is 80.5 inches, with August being the wettest month (23.4") and November the driest (0.7").
